3.在Linux服务器中新增了一块硬盘/dev/sdb,要求Linux系统的分区能自动调整磁盘容量。请使用fdisk命令新建/dev/sdb1、/dev/sdb2、/dev/sdb3LVM类型的分区,并在这4个分区上创建物理卷、卷组和逻辑卷。最后将逻辑卷挂载。(20分)。过程代码
时间: 2023-12-16 09:04:13 浏览: 98
linux 分区格式化挂载 物理卷 逻辑卷.docx
好的,下面是具体的步骤和代码:
1. 使用fdisk命令新建/dev/sdb1、/dev/sdb2、/dev/sdb3LVM类型的分区。
```shell
sudo fdisk /dev/sdb
```
然后输入n创建分区,选择分区类型为LVM(输入t,然后选择8e),保存退出。
2. 在这4个分区上创建物理卷。
```shell
sudo pvcreate /dev/sdb1 /dev/sdb2 /dev/sdb3
```
3. 创建卷组。
```shell
sudo vgcreate vg_test /dev/sdb1 /dev/sdb2 /dev/sdb3
```
4. 创建逻辑卷。
```shell
sudo lvcreate -L 10G -n lv_test1 vg_test
sudo lvcreate -L 20G -n lv_test2 vg_test
sudo lvcreate -L 30G -n lv_test3 vg_test
```
这里创建了三个逻辑卷,分别为lv_test1、lv_test2、lv_test3。
5. 格式化文件系统。
```shell
sudo mkfs.ext4 /dev/vg_test/lv_test1
sudo mkfs.ext4 /dev/vg_test/lv_test2
sudo mkfs.ext4 /dev/vg_test/lv_test3
```
6. 挂载逻辑卷。
```shell
sudo mkdir /mnt/lv_test1
sudo mkdir /mnt/lv_test2
sudo mkdir /mnt/lv_test3
sudo mount /dev/vg_test/lv_test1 /mnt/lv_test1
sudo mount /dev/vg_test/lv_test2 /mnt/lv_test2
sudo mount /dev/vg_test/lv_test3 /mnt/lv_test3
```
这里将三个逻辑卷分别挂载到/mnt/lv_test1、/mnt/lv_test2、/mnt/lv_test3。
7. 查看分区和挂载情况。
```shell
sudo fdisk -l
df -h
```
这里使用fdisk命令查看分区情况,使用df命令查看挂载情况。
以上就是新增硬盘并自动调整磁盘容量的过程和代码,希望对你有帮助。
阅读全文